Output 7718db7adb15eb3b6656cf7c0fd6cf4bfb6595e1900f75c003dbc46e4c94df30:4

value
84105274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6c257eca5698e4e335170aeee70b9858d1826d OP_EQUAL
address
3HbH453BXL7v5pnor9b5gB7akzuLnwU7n3
transaction
7718db7adb15eb3b6656cf7c0fd6cf4bfb6595e1900f75c003dbc46e4c94df30
spent
true